Output 695aedf824c38c7893c98e474c9bb8b5b699044b2ab274d9e7448a99ea3346a9:1

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 3ea5dc57256df5d631b814c042138362e8723fb0
address
bc1q86jac4e9dh6avvdcznqyyyurvt58y0askh40k6
transaction
695aedf824c38c7893c98e474c9bb8b5b699044b2ab274d9e7448a99ea3346a9